Two types of flares are tested for their burning times (in minutes) and sample results are given below.

Brand X Brand Y

n = 35 n = 40

x = 19.4 x = 15.1

s = 1.4 s = 0.8

Refer to the sample data to test the claim that the two populations have unequal means. Use a 95% confidence level. State null and alternative hypothesis along with your final conclusion.
